Mediation is often an option when all parties involved are willing to come to the table open-minded and ready to negotiate. It also helps if the parties involved are somewhat equal in power.
Types of disputes that lend themselves to Mediation include small claims disputes where smaller amounts of money or neighborhood agreements are in question. Contract and land-use disputes as well as landlord/tenant issues may be served by Mediation. Divorce and child custody cases may also benefit from Mediation because they allow parties to work collaboratively to come to creative solutions for their situations.
